5. Don't Get Angry

5. Don't Get Angry
Who's not getting angry in this short? No one. Which is to say, everyone is getting angry. And who's everyone? Kids. Adorable 1950s kids with names like Priscilla and Carol, and oceans of rage right under the surface. From jump rope gone wrong to a flaky friend canceling plans, virtually anything can set these kids off into a punch-throwing, spittle-flecked tantrum.
4. On Guard - Bunco!

4. On Guard - Bunco!
On Guard - Bunco! provides a hard-hitting and, if you take good notes, potentially lucrative look into the world of con-men! Scams covered include "The Encyclopedia Flim Flamica" "The Widow's Bankroll Do-see-do" and the always crowd-pleasing "Paint a Guy's Roof then Threaten to Beat Him Up." For good measure there's a grand finale involving needless racism!
3. The Value of Teamwork

3. The Value of Teamwork
It's a sweet classic tale, all about a boy and his dog. Except the boy is an irritable loner who doesn't play well with others, and the dog talks to him and tells him what to do. Nothing ominous or terrifying about that, right? Fortunately this particular dog is less into commanding murders and more into team-building exercises and being a nice kid, that kind of stuff.

1. The Tiny Astronaut

1. The Tiny Astronaut
A short from the golden age of space travel, when it was mostly about putting confused animals in giant explosive rockets and seeing what happened. But the twist this time is that the endangered mouse is a young boy's beloved pet. Will the boy save his mouse? Will the rocket launch go off as planned?
